Gelatin Fruit Salad

1 Tbsp. unflavored gelatin
2 Tbsp. cold water
1 1/2 c. orange juice
12 large marshmallows
1/2 c. lemon juice
2 c. heavy cream
1 can fruit cocktail, drained

Soften gelatin in cold water. Heat 1/2 c. orange juice and marshmallows in top of double boiler over hot water until marshmallows are melted. Add softened gelatin. Stir until dissolved. Add remaining orange and lemon juice. Coo. Whip cream and add gelatin mixture gradually. Fill the Tupperware Jel-Ring mold with fruit cocktail and pour gelatin mixture over fruit. Seal and chill in the refrigerator for 6 hours until set.

Black Walnut Salad

1 pkg. lemon jello
1 c. crushed pineapple
9 large marshmallows
8 ounce cream cheese
1 c. water plus pineapple juice from crushed pineapples
chopped walnuts
1 c. Cool Whip

Heat jello and water in saucepan; add marshmallows and cheese, stirring until all melted. Let sit until cooled for 5-10 minutes. Add remaining ingredients. Stir and p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old. Seal and refrigerate for 6 hours until set. Unmold onto a serving plate.

Strawberry Pineapple Salad Mold

8 ounce cream cheese, softened
2 (3 ounce) pkgs. strawberry jello
2/3 c. sugar
2 c. hot water
1 c. chopped nuts
16 oz. can crushed pineapples, drained
16 oz. container Cool Whip

Dissolve jello in hot water with sugar. Add cream cheese, stir until blended. Chill until partly set. Add nuts, pineapple and Cool Whip and beat with a hand beater. P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old and chill for a few hours until set. Unmold onto a serving plate.

Raspberry Cream Gelatin Salad

3 oz. pkg. raspberry gelatin
1 c. whipping cream, whipped
10 oz. frozen, thawed, drained raspberries

Dissolve gelatin as directed on package, using 1 c. boiling water and berry juice with cold water to make 1 cup. Chill until almost firm. Beat gelatin until foamy. Fold together whipped gelatin, whipped cream and drained berries. Pour into Jel-Ring mold and refrigerate until firm.

Spring Gelatin Salad

3 oz. pkg. orange gelatin
1/4 c. sugar
1 1/2 c. boiling water
8 ounce cream cheese, softened
1/2 c. orange juice
2 Tbsp. lemon juice
1 c. shredded carrots
1 c. finely chopped celery

Dissolve gelatin and sugar in boiling water. Add orange juice and cream cheese, stir until dissolved and blended. Add remaining ingredients. Pour into the Jel-Ring mold and refrigerate until firm. (about 6 hours).

Orange Gelatin Mold

1 (6 ounce) pkg. orange gelatin
2 c. boiling water
1 pint orange sherbet
1 can mandarin oranges, drained

Dissolve gelatin in boiling water. Add sherbet. Using saucy silicone spatula stir until melted and dissolved. Add in the mandarin oranges. Pour into Jel-Ring mold and refrigerate until set. Unmold onto a serving plate.

Pear Salad

1 (16 ounce) can pears
3 ounce pkg. lime jello
8 ounce cream cheese, softened
8 ounce Cool Whip

Strain pears and bring pear juice to a boil. Using saucy silicone spatula, stir in the lime jello until dissolved. Combine pears, cream cheese and 4 Tbsp. jello mixture in the blender and blend until smooth. Add remaining jello mixture and blend again. Pour into a bowl and refrigerate for 1 hour. Remove from refrigerator and fold in the Cool Whip using the saucy silicone spatula. P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old and seal. Refrigerate for 6 hours. Unmold onto a serving plate lined with some lettuce leaves.

Blueberry Banana Salad

1 can blueberry pie filling
6 ounce pkg. raspberry gelatin
1/2 c. chopped nuts
8 ounce Cool Whip
1-2 bananas

Prepare gelatin as directed on package. Put in refrigerator until almost jelled. Remove and stir in the blueberry pie filling. Pour into the Jel-Ring mold and chill until set. Slice bananas and put on gelatin, then sprinkle chopped nuts over the bananas and add the Cool Whip on top.

Dreamy Pineapple Gelatin Mold

1 sm. pkg. lemon gelatin
1 sm. pkg. lime gelatin
2 c. boiling water
1 (8 ounce) pkg. cream cheese
12 oz. crushed pineapple and juice
1 pkg. dream whip

Dissolve gelatins in boiling water. Mix in cream cheese on low speed. Add pineapple and let stand until it starts to jell. Beat dream whip, fold into gelatin mixture. P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old, seal and refrigerate until firm.

Egg Salad Mold

1 sm. pkg. lemon gelatin, dissolved in 1/2 c. hot water
1 (8 ounce) pkg. cream cheese
6 hard-cooked eggs, diced
1 c. celery, chopped
1/2 c. finely chopped onion
2 Tbsp. salad dressing

Mix gelatin and water. Add in cream cheese and mix well. Add all other ingredients and stir together until blended. P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old and seal. Chill overnight. Unmold. Serve with crackers or hard crust bread.

Orange Pineapple Gelatin Salad

2 (3 ounce) boxes orange gelatin
2 c. boiling water
1 sm. can frozen orange juice, undiluted
1 sm. can mandarin oranges, drained
1 (15 ounce) can crushed pineapple, undrained

Mix first 3 ingredients together until mixture starts to jell, then add the last 2 ingredients. Mix all together and p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old, seal. Refrigerate until firm.

Mimosa Gelatin Mold

1 1/2 c. boiling water
1 pkg. (8 serving size) orange flavor gelatin
2 c. cold club soda
1 can (11 oz) mandarin orange sements, drained
1 c. sliced strawberries

Whipped topping, thawed, toasted coconut and additional strawberries for garnish (optional)

Stir boiling water into gelatin in a large bowl at least 2 minutes until completely dissolved. Stir in club soda. Refrigerate for 1 1/2 hours or until thickened. Stir in oranges and strawberries. P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old.

Refrigerate for 4 hours or until firm. Garnish center with whipped topping, toasted coconut and additional strawberries if desired.

Waldorf Gelatin Mold

1 pkg. (3 ounce) Lemon Flavored Gelatin
1/2 tsp. salt
1 c. boiling water
3/4 c. cold water
2 tsp. vinegar
3/4 c. finely diced celery
1 c. diced red apples
1/4 c. chopped walnuts
1/4 c. mayonnaise (optional)

Dissolve gelatin and salt in boiling water. Add cold water and vinegar. Chill until very thick. Fold in celery, apples, walnuts and mayonnaise. Spoon into individual molds or a 1 quart mold. Chill until firm. Unmold and serve with cream cheese or whipped topping.

Vanilla Bavarian Cream Dessert

1 envelope unflavored gelatin
1/4 c. cold water
2 egg yolks
1/2 c. sugar
1/4 tsp. salt
1 c. milk
1 tsp. vanilla
2 egg whites
1 c. whipping cream

In the Tupperware Thatsa Bowl soften gelatin in water. Beat in another bowl egg yolks; add 1/4 c. sugar and salt. Gradually add in milk; cook over hot water or in a double boiler, stirring constantly, until thick. Add gelatin, stir until dissolved. Add vanilla. Chill until slightly thickened. Beat egg whites until stiff; gradually add remaining 1/4 c. sugar, beating constantly. Whip cream slightly stiff; fold into gelatin mixture with egg whites. P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old, seal and chill until firm. Serves 4-6.

Triple Orange Gelatin Salad Mold

6 oz. pkg. orange gelatin
2 c. boiling water
1 pint of orange sherbet
1 can mandarin oranges, drained

Dissolve orange gelatin in boiling water. Add sherbet, stir until melted. Add mandarin orange slices. Pour into the Tupperware Jel-Ring Mold, seal and refrigerate for 4-6 hours until set.

*optional* You can serve your gelatin salad with some whip cream if desired.
